Why Is High Heat Essential for Achieving Perfect Pizza Texture?
High heat is essential for achieving perfect pizza texture because it ensures proper cooking and creates a desirable crust. High temperatures, typically between 475°F to 800°F (245°C to 427°C), help to cook the dough quickly while allowing the cheese and toppings to melt evenly.
According to the American Culinary Federation, high heat contributes to a more appealing texture by promoting the Maillard reaction, which is a chemical reaction between sugars and amino acids that gives browned food its distinctive flavor and crispness.
The underlying reasons for the necessity of high heat include moisture evaporation, dough structure development, and ingredient interaction. When pizza cooks at high temperatures, moisture quickly evaporates from the dough, which prevents sogginess. Simultaneously, the intense heat activates proteins and starches within the dough, leading to a well-structured crust that is chewy on the inside and crispy on the outside.
Key technical terms include:
– Maillard reaction: This is the process that occurs when food is browned, contributing to flavor and texture.
– Caramelization: This refers to the browning of sugar, which adds sweetness and depth to the crust.
High temperatures affect the baking process significantly. For instance, when a pizza stone is heated, it retains heat and evenly distributes it to the pizza base. As the dough contacts the hot surface, it starts to rise and form bubbles. This rising creates a light and airy texture. Additionally, ingredients like cheese melt and brown, enhancing overall flavor and texture.
Specific conditions that contribute to optimal pizza texture include the use of a preheated pizza stone or steel, which can simulate a traditional pizza oven’s environment. When baking at 500°F (260°C) or higher, the cooking time can be reduced to mere minutes, supporting the development of a crisp crust while maintaining a soft interior. For example, Neapolitan-style pizzas are cooked quickly at temperatures around 900°F (482°C) for about 90 seconds, resulting in the signature charred crust and airy texture.
How Do Lumpwood Charcoal and Briquettes Differ in Performance for Pizza Ovens?
Lumpwood charcoal and briquettes differ in performance for pizza ovens based on ignition time, heat output, burn duration, and flavor imparted to the food.
Lumpwood charcoal ignites quickly. It requires around 15-20 minutes to reach high temperatures. In contrast, briquettes take longer, approximately 30-45 minutes, to start burning at optimal heat. This difference impacts the preparation time for pizza cooking.
Heat output varies significantly. Lumpwood charcoal can reach temperatures exceeding 1,000°F (537°C). This high heat is ideal for cooking pizza quickly, achieving a crispy crust. Briquettes typically burn at lower temperatures, around 600°F (316°C). This may prolong cooking time and affect the texture of the pizza.
Burn duration also differs. Lumpwood charcoal burns faster, lasting about 1-2 hours. Its rapid burn may require more frequent refueling during lengthy cooking sessions. On the other hand, briquettes have a longer burn time, lasting up to 4-5 hours. This extended duration can be beneficial for longer cooking times, though it may not provide the necessary heat for a perfect bake.
Flavor characteristics are another distinction. Lumpwood charcoal produces a smoky flavor from natural wood species, enhancing the taste of the pizza. In contrast, briquettes are often made from compressed sawdust and may contain additives. These additives can result in a less desirable taste compared to lumpwood charcoal.
Overall, when considering performance for pizza ovens, lumpwood charcoal excels in quick ignition, high heat, and flavor. Briquettes provide longevity and steadiness but may fall short in achieving optimal cooking conditions for pizza.

How Do Briquettes Contribute to Cooking Consistency and Temperature Control in Pizza Ovens?
Briquettes contribute to cooking consistency and temperature control in pizza ovens by providing a stable source of heat and enhancing the cooking process.
- Stable heat output: Briquettes offer a consistent burn rate, allowing for even heat distribution. This stable heat prevents hot spots and helps maintain a uniform cooking temperature throughout the oven.
- Temperature retention: The dense structure of briquettes enables them to retain heat for extended periods. This property allows the oven to maintain its temperature longer, which is crucial for achieving the ideal conditions for baking pizzas.
- Enhanced cooking environment: Using briquettes can create a dry, radiant heat that is beneficial for pizza cooking. This heat mode supports the rapid cooking of dough while ensuring the crust develops the desired texture.
- Controlled ignition: Briquettes ignite at a controlled rate, allowing users to manage the start-up phase efficiently. This controlled ignition helps avoid temperature spikes, which can negatively affect cooking quality.
- Eco-friendly option: Many briquettes are made from natural materials and do not contain harmful additives. This makes them a cleaner option, contributing to a healthier cooking environment and potentially enhancing the flavor of the pizza.
- Improved cooking time: Consistent temperature control via briquettes can reduce the cooking time for pizzas. The ability to maintain an optimal temperature leads to quicker cooking while ensuring the best results.
In summary, briquettes promote cooking consistency and effective temperature control, crucial for excellent pizza preparation.

What Common Mistakes Should You Avoid When Choosing Charcoal for Your Pizza Oven?
To avoid common mistakes when choosing charcoal for your pizza oven, focus on several key factors.
- Using low-quality charcoal
- Selecting unsuitable charcoal size
- Ignoring the charcoal type
- Overlooking additives and fillers
- Failing to consider burn time
When selecting charcoal, it is important to make informed choices regarding quality, size, type, and additives to achieve the best cooking results.
-
Using Low-Quality Charcoal: Using low-quality charcoal can lead to poor flavor in your pizza. Low-grade charcoal often produces excess ash and can impart undesirable chemical flavors. High-quality hardwood charcoal is recommended for cleaner burns and better taste. According to a study by Chef John, using premium hardwood charcoal improves the overall pizza flavor significantly.
-
Selecting Unsuitable Charcoal Size: Selecting charcoal that is too large or too small can affect heat distribution and cook time. Large pieces may take longer to ignite and produce inconsistent heat. On the other hand, very small pieces can burn too quickly. Ideally, choose a uniform size that allows even burning. A 2019 review in Cooking Journal highlighted that uniform charcoal sizes lead to better temperature control in pizza ovens.
-
Ignoring the Charcoal Type: Ignoring the specific type of charcoal can impact the cooking process. Different types, such as lump charcoal and briquettes, have different burning properties. Lump charcoal ignites faster and burns hotter, while briquettes provide a stable and consistent heat. According to culinary expert Mark Bittman, lump charcoal is favored for pizza ovens due to its high temperatures and quick heating times.
-
Overlooking Additives and Fillers: Overlooking additives and fillers in charcoal can result in unwanted flavors. Some briquettes contain chemicals and binders that can affect the taste of food. It is important to choose products that are 100% natural and free from additives.
